The Manager, Finance Operations serves as a strategic business partner to the distribution and logistics teams. This role drives operational excellence by delivering financial analysis, forecasting, and insights that improve efficiency, reduce costs, and support decision-making across the supply chain. The analyst will play a pivotal role in translating data into actionable recommendations, developing KPI dashboards, and collaborating with cross-functional partners to optimize performance.


Key Responsibilities

Financial Analysis & Reporting

  • Prepare and deliver accurate, timely financial reports for supply chain functions (distribution, logistics, and inventory).
  • Conduct variance and trend analyses to identify cost drivers, risks, and opportunities for efficiency/profitability improvements.
  • Conduct variance analyses for freight and duty actuals vs standard
  • Support month-end and quarter-end close processes, including accruals, reconciliations, and variance commentary.
  • Develop Monthly Inventory reporting to capture inventory and SKU data by division by aging bucket including SKU productivity metrics.
  • Develop financial models to evaluate warehouse performance, capital investments, and operational initiatives.

Budgeting & Forecasting

  • Lead annual budgeting and ongoing forecasting for supply chain operations, including operating expenses, capital expenditures, and unit flows by division by order type.
  • Review and update distribution forecasts based on changing supply and demand conditions-unit flows
  • Monitor performance against forecasts, identify variances, and recommend corrective actions.
  • Support long-range financial planning and scenario modeling to assess operational strategies.
  • Assist with warehouse labor planning (permanent and temporary)

KPI & Dashboard Development

  • Design, build, and maintain dashboards to track KPIs for distribution, logistics, and inventory functions.
  • Partner with IT and operations teams to extract and structure data from multiple sources, ensuring integrity and consistency.
  • Train stakeholders on dashboard use and interpretation to strengthen data-driven decision-making.

Business Partnership & Collaboration

  • Serve as a trusted advisor to Distribution Center management, logistics leaders, and division finance/sales teams.
  • Implement recurring monthly/quarterly cross functional meetings to review financial performance and KPI’s to discuss trends and identify opportunities for improvement.
  • Translate financial data into insights for non-financial stakeholders, supporting cost savings and operational improvements.
  • Participate in strategic projects, supplier negotiations, and inventory optimization initiatives.

Process Improvement & Operational Support

  • Evaluate and enhance financial reporting and planning processes for efficiency and automation.
  • Drive continuous improvement initiatives to reduce costs, improve service levels, and optimize distribution and operations network.
  • Support compliance, internal controls, and best practices in financial management.

Qualifications & Experience

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Supply Chain, Business Administration, or a related field.
  • 5+ years of experience in financial or operational analysis supporting supply chain, logistics, or distribution center operations.
  • Hands-on experience analyzing distribution center KPIs, including cost per unit (CPU), unit flow, throughput, labor productivity, and capacity utilization.
  • Proven ability to analyze and forecast inbound and outbound unit flows across freight and distribution operations.
  • Experience performing SKU-level analysis to evaluate productivity, shipment trends, and operational efficiency.
  • Advanced Excel skills (complex formulas, large data sets, dashboard creation) and experience with Power BI or similar BI tools to build operational dashboards and reporting.
  • Strong understanding of distribution, logistics, and inventory flow, including the operational drivers behind cost and efficiency in a DC environment.
  • Experience supporting labor tracking and distribution center optimization initiatives, including monitoring labor productivity and cost per unit metrics.
  • Ability to translate operational data into actionable insights and communicate findings clearly to cross-functional partners.
  • Strong cross-functional collaboration skills, with experience working closely with distribution, logistics, inventory planning, and operations teams.
  • Excellent problem-solving, analytical, and organizational skills with a proactive, continuous improvement mindset.
